What to expect
This is a typical itinerary for this product
Stop At: Shore Temple Rd, Mahabalipuram 603104 India
We head straight to Mahabalipuram Shore temple to Witness a Morning Sun Glittering ont he waves and temple
Duration: 2 hours
Stop At: Mudaliyarkuppam, Tamil Nadu 605107, India
A boat house run by Tamil Nadu state tourism department is our next stop over En-route Pondicherry
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: Pondicherry Lighthouse, Dubrayapet, Pondicherry 605004 India
Enjoy the open beach view from the light house.
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: Sri Aurobindo Ashram, Rue de la Marine, Pondicherry India
A must see for the spiritually inclined
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: Pondicherry french colony, WRJM+2MF, Dumas St, White Town, Puducherry, 605001, India
Ride Along the French Quarters admiring the architecture & tasting some local refreshments
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: Pondicherry Museum, Rue Romain Rolland, Pondicherry 605001 India
A Visit to the History of Pondicherry before we stop for Lunch
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: 1, Sadhana Forest Road, Auroville 605101 India
After a sumptuous lunch we start out return journey for the day visiting this mangrove forest to rest a while.
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: Alamparai Fort, 50 km from Mamallapuram, Kanchipuram 604303 India
En-route to Chennai we take a slight de tour to visit this yester year fort
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: Sadras, Sadras, Chennai District, Tamil Nadu
one more detour to this Dutch fort before we start towards the end of the trip to Chennai.
Duration: 1 hour
Stop At: Elliot's Beach, Near Besant Nagar, Chennai (Madras) India
Before we end the day we would have a final stop at this city beach to enjoy some local flavors. & Get dropped at the hotel to end the long day.
Duration: 2 hours
